Azerbaijan to ease visa rules ahead of World Chess Olympiad

Azerbaijan would relax visa rules for foreign and stateless persons in a bid to simplify the visa procedure for foreign visitors ahead of the 2016 World Chess Olympiad in Baku.

On April 18, 2016 President of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ev signed a decree on simplifying the visa procedures for foreigners and stateless persons arriving in Azerbaijan for organizing and holding the World Chess Olympiad.

According to decree, foreigners and stateless persons, arriving in Azerbaijan for organizing and holding the World Chess Olympiad, can get visas at the structural subdivisions of the foreign ministry's consular department in Azerbaijan's international airports.

 A document confirming accreditation in line with rules of the International Chess Federation or official invitation letter issued by the  Baku Chess Olympiad Operating Committee  can be considered as a basis for visa issuance.

The holders of aforementioned documents can apply for visa from August 20 till September 20. The 42nd Chess Olympiad, will take place in Baku, Azerbaijan from September 1-14 in 2016.
